Oxmoor Mazda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Oxmoor Mazda in the United States is $87,358.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Oxmoor Mazda typically range from $76,809 to $98,819 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Louisville?

Understanding the cost of living near Louisville is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Oxmoor Mazda.
Louisville's Cost of Living Index is approximately 87.8 (12.2% less expensive than US average; 5.5% less than KY average). Largest KY city, Kentucky Derby, affordable housing. TARC b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Oxmoor Mazda,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$900 - $1,400+ A significant portion of Oxmoor Mazda sal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$50 (TARC mon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,180 - $3,500+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
